Factors to Consider When Choosing a Packable Laundry Bag

When you choose a packable laundry bag, prioritize material and durability—opt for water‑resistant nylon or polyester that can handle heavy loads and frequent use. Next, evaluate weight and portability alongside capacity and size to guarantee it collapses small yet holds your trip’s dirty clothes without bulk. Finally, check design features like zippers or compartments and versatility for uses beyond laundry, matching your travel habits.

Material and Durability

Select machine‑washable bags for effortless cleaning after trips. Look for reinforced stitching and robust construction to prevent seam splits under heavy loads, ensuring longevity across multiple journeys.

Weight and Portability

Prioritize lightweight options—some models weigh as little as 2.6 oz—so they won’t add noticeable weight to your luggage. Even the heavier 7.4‑oz bags stay manageable, and many include handles or carabiners for easy clipping to backpacks.

Capacity and Size

Typical capacity falls between 22 lb and 30 lb, with expanded dimensions around 24″ × 21″. When folded, they shrink to roughly 6″ × 6″, fitting easily into any suitcase or daypack.

Design Features

Upgraded handles, safety drawstring sliders, and outer zipper pockets add convenience. Collapsible designs that fold flat save space, and high‑density nylon or polyester resists wear over repeated trips.

Versatility and Use Cases

Beyond laundry, these bags store gym gear, wet towels, socks, or even small toys. Drawstring closures and pockets let you stash detergent or keys for quick access, making them useful in dorms, campsites, or car‑trunks.

Price and Value

Expect to pay $10‑$30 for a quality set. Higher‑priced options often include stronger waterproof coatings or longer warranties, while budget models still deliver solid durability for everyday travel.

Warranty and Support

Most brands offer a 30‑day Amazon return window; a few provide extended warranties (up to 90 days). Check the seller’s support options before buying to ensure quick resolution if a seam fails.

Frequently Asked Questions

How Long Do Packable Laundry Bags Last?

Heavy‑duty bags typically endure 18–36 months of regular use, or 50‑200+ wash cycles when cared for properly (cold wash, mild detergent, air‑dry). Inspect seams quarterly and avoid high‑heat drying to extend life.

Are Packable Laundry Bags Machine Washable?

Many models—including the JHX and Pink/Gray sets—are safe for machine washing on a gentle cycle. Some polyester bags recommend hand washing to preserve coating integrity. Always follow the manufacturer’s care label.

Can Packable Laundry Bags Prevent Odors?

Yes. Bags with sealed drawstrings or zip closures trap moisture, while breathable mesh options help reduce mildew. Some brands add antimicrobial treatments for extra odor control.

Do Packable Laundry Bags Fit Airline Carry‑Ons?

All of the bags reviewed fold down to a size under 7″ × 7″, easily slipping into a standard carry‑on pocket or the side compartment of a small backpack.

Are Packable Laundry Bags Waterproof?

Most are water‑resistant rather than fully waterproof. The Isink and WiseBoy bags repel rain, but submersion will eventually let water seep in. If you need true waterproof protection, look for bags with taped seams and a PU coating.
